WebSep 11, 2024 · Research suggests that it improves reading fluency, expands vocabulary, and increases students’ confidence. Partner reading is another low-stakes, research-backed strategy. A pair of students alternate reading a text aloud, then taking the role of the listener. The listener asks probing questions to check that the reader comprehends the text. WebRead the Same Book Over and Over. Reading the same book again and again isn’t boring for your child. In fact, kids love seeing their favorite book repeatedly for several reasons. First, reading a book over and over helps children predict language. Second, when kids know what is coming next you can let them “fill in the blank” when reading ...

WebNov 5, 2024 · Being read the same story four times rather than two times improved 1.5- and two-year-olds’ accuracy in reproducing the actions needed to make a toy rattle. Similarly, doubling exposure to a video demonstration for 12- to 21-month olds improved their memory of the target actions.
